How much do vacation resort in j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for vacation resort in in Riviera Beach, FL is $17.25,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.29 and $18.80 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a vacation resort?

Vacation resorts are hospitality establishments that provide accommodations and a variety of recreational facilities designed for relaxation and leisure. They often offer amenities such as swimming pools, restaurants, spas, entertainment, and organized activities, all within a single property or location. Vacation resorts can be found in diverse settings, including beaches, mountains, and theme parks, catering to families, couples, and groups. Their goal is to create a convenient and enjoyable environment where guests can unwind and enjoy their time away from home.

What are some common challenges faced by employees working in a vacation resort, and how can new hires prepare for them?

Employees at vacation resorts often encounter challenges such as managing high guest volumes during peak seasons, adapting to fast-paced and dynamic environments, and ensuring consistent, high-quality customer service. New hires can prepare by developing strong communication skills, learning to multitask effectively, and familiarizing themselves with hospitality best practices. Teamwork is essential, as resort staff frequently collaborate across departments to address guest needs and create memorable experiences.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a vacation resort man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Vacation Resort Manager, you need strong leadership, hospitality management expertise, and typically a degree in hospitality or a related field. Familiarity with property management systems, booking software, and industry-standard certifications like CHA (Certified Hotel Administrator) are common requirements. Exceptional communication, problem-solving, and customer service skills help you exceed guest expectations and manage diverse teams. These competencies are vital to ensure seamless operations, guest satisfaction, and business success in a competitive hospitality environment.

Job description

Onia is a luxury resort-wear brand inspired by effortless elegance, exceptional craftsmanship, and the art of living beautifully. Our collections are designed for sophisticated, modern travelers who value distinctive design, quality, and an elevated sense of style.

We are seeking a Seasonal Sales Associate to join our team and help create an exceptional experience for every client who walks through our doors.


The Opportunity

As a Seasonal Sales Associate, you will be a key ambassador for Onia, delivering highly personalized service while supporting the day-to-day success of our boutique. You will connect with clients, offer thoughtful styling advice, develop lasting relationships, and contribute to achieving both individual and store sales goals.

The ideal candidate is naturally warm and engaging, passionate about fashion and travel, and understands that luxury retail is about much more than the transaction—it is about creating a memorable experience.

Responsibilities
  • Deliver an elevated, personalized client experience that reflects the spirit and values of the brand.
  • Welcome and engage clients with warmth, professionalism, and genuine enthusiasm.
  • Develop meaningful relationships with new and returning clients through exceptional service and thoughtful follow-up.
  • Provide expert styling guidance and curate complete resort, vacation, and occasion looks.
  • Build strong knowledge of the brand, collections, fabrics, craftsmanship, fit, and seasonal assortment.
  • Actively contribute to individual and team sales goals and KPIs.
  • Utilize clienteling and CRM tools to maintain client relationships and drive repeat business.
  • Assist with outreach, special appointments, trunk shows, private events, and other client engagement initiatives.
  • Maintain impeccable presentation of the sales floor, merchandise, fitting rooms, and overall boutique environment.
  • Assist with receiving, replenishment, inventory organization, stockroom maintenance, and product transfers.
  • Process transactions accurately and efficiently using POS systems.
  • Work collaboratively with the store team to ensure a seamless client experience.
  • Represent the brand with a polished appearance, positive attitude, discretion, and professionalism at all times.
Who You Are
  • Previous experience in luxury, contemporary, resort, hospitality, or premium retail is preferred.
  • A genuine passion for fashion, styling, travel, and luxury lifestyle.
  • Naturally warm, personable, and confident engaging with a discerning clientele.
  • Strong sales and relationship-building skills with a service-oriented approach.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Highly organized, detail-oriented, and comfortable in a fast-paced environment.
  • Professional, polished, and enthusiastic with a strong sense of personal style.
  • Comfortable working toward sales goals and using POS/CRM systems.
  • A team player who takes initiative and can adapt to the needs of the business.
  • Flexible availability, including weekends, evenings, and holidays during peak resort and seasonal periods.
What We Offer
  • The opportunity to represent an elevated luxury resort-wear brand.
  • A dynamic, fashion-forward retail environment.
  • Employee merchandise benefits.
  • Commission
  • Potential opportunity for continued employment based on business needs and performance.
